Graphics are a combination of various things, Polygons, textures, AA, Framerate, Resolution, not to mention other things devs have to juggle like physics, particles, etc.

Resolution is what this thread is about? That's nice, but remember, there is more to it that that. As far as mocking the PS3, 360, and Wii for being consoles, remember, consoles have FIXED hardware PC's don't. You can upgrade PC's every year.
